As we concluded our last program I pointed out that understanding the Scriptures was foundational to the disciples experiencing all they would need to accomplish their mission. Acts, chapter one, amplifies the final days of Jesus’ time with the disciples before His ascension. During this time He gave them many convincing proofs that He was alive. On one occasion, while eating with them, He gave them this command: “Do not leave Jerusalem, but wait for the gift my Father promised.” When the disciples asked Him, “Lord, are you at this time going to restore the kingdom to Israel?” He answered them, “It is not for you to know the times or dates the Father has set by his own authority. But you will receive power when the Holy Spirit comes on you; and you will be my witnesses in Jerusalem, and in all Judea and Samaria, and to the ends of the earth.” Knowing the Scriptures is important in being prepared to represent the Lord to the world, but none of us know everything. There are some things you have to leave in the Father’s hands. But once you understand that Jesus provided forgiveness of sins to those who repent and believe in His death and resurrection you will need to trust in the Holy Spirit to empower you to be a witness of this good news. Once you believe in Jesus Christ as your Savior the Holy Spirit dwells in you. To be empowered for service you must surrender fully to His control and rely upon Him to work through you. It would be wise to memorize Acts 1:8, the final promise of Jesus before His ascension.
